Output 86aa759a00a4699d307df7b6b995f5bc8b8484a7c977d665f3c83be71d381487:0

value
18973141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757c3f2cde23d5e653bd5d0c4c99750b759aa369 OP_EQUAL
address
3CQDpofgNsnUBio59QabxBRmc2JzYuraQm
transaction
86aa759a00a4699d307df7b6b995f5bc8b8484a7c977d665f3c83be71d381487
confirmations
448538
spent
true